2 Confidence-Building Tools for Parents to Set Kids Up for 'A Lifetime of Success,' From a Mental Performance Coach

Parents who prioritize boosting their kids' confidence are 'setting them up for a lifetime of success,' says mental performance coach Cindra Kamphoff.

TL;DR

  • Parents must prioritize boosting their children's self-esteem to ensure future success and happiness.
  • A 'confidence crisis' exists, with a significant portion of Gen Z workers and U.S. teens reporting low confidence and inadequate emotional support.
  • Nurturing confidence helps children develop independence and resilience to overcome challenges and take necessary risks.
  • Two key strategies for parents include teaching children to manage their 'inner critic' and normalizing failure.
  • To manage the 'inner critic,' parents can teach kids to identify negative self-talk and replace it with truth using questions like 'Is that true?' and 'Is that thought serving you?'.
  • Normalizing failure involves teaching children that setbacks are learning opportunities and not permanent definitions of self.
  • The 'Learn-Burn-Return' method helps children move past failures by identifying lessons, disengaging from the mistake, and returning to a positive mindset with confident self-talk.
